A St. George man died from injuries he received in a Sunday morning rollover crash on Interstate 15 in Nevada.

The Nevada Highway Patrol reported that the driver of a 2001 Hyundai car was northbound on the interstate when the driver lost control and veered into the center median where the car rolled into the southbound lane.

One of the passengers, 19-year-old Nathan M. Short, was ejected from the car during the rollover. He was taken Las Vegas's University Medical Center by air ambulance and was pronounced dead Sunday night. The remaining three occupants in the car also were taken to the hospital with non-life threatening injuries.

No one in the car was wearing a seatbelt at the time of the crash, officials reported.
